Tucked away in the foothills south of Ivarstead, the Ruins of Bthalft are the moss-covered remains of a small Dwemer outpost, long forgotten by most of Skyrim. Overgrown with ivy and surrounded by scattered stonework and Dwemer scrap, the ruins lie silent—until the Dragonborn gathers the four Aetherium Shards during the quest Lost to the Ages. When activated, the ruins transform dramatically. Ancient Dwemer machinery rises from the ground, assembling the Aetherium Forge Elevator—a marvel of lost engineering that grants access to one of the most powerful crafting sites in Tamriel. From this unassuming site, the path opens to the legendary Aetherium Forge deep beneath the mountains. The Ruins of Bthalft are more than just rubble—they are the key to unlocking the secrets of Aetherium, where Dwemer ambition still hums beneath the earth, waiting for the next soul bold enough to wield it.
